Carlsbad roofing scope splits cleanly into two working categories. The older beach-area inventory through Carlsbad Village, Olde Carlsbad, Barrio, and the streets feeding the Highway 101 corridor is mostly pre-1980 composition shingle and original tile on smaller lots, with mid-century beach bungalow character and salt-grade specification requirements throughout. The newer master-plan inventory through La Costa, Aviara, Bressi Ranch, Calavera Hills, and Rancho Carrillo dominates total household count, heavy master-planned communities built from the late 1980s through the 2010s, mostly concrete tile on single-family with HOA architectural standards across all visible work.

My La Costa tile roof is original from the late 1980s, what should I expect?

Most original La Costa tile roofs from the late 1980s are in or past their first major underlayment service life. The tile itself usually salvages fine. The underlayment beneath the tile is the actual functional barrier, and at 35-40 years it is typically failed or near-failed. Plan a tile lift-and-relay within the next one to three years if you have not done one already. Typical 2,200-3,000 sq ft La Costa single-family runs $15,000-$26,000 for the lift-and-relay.

How does Aviara HOA architectural review work for roof projects?

The Aviara master association architectural committee reviews all visible roof projects for color, profile, material, and assembly consistency with community standards. We handle the submission package and have prior approvals on file for the standard tile profiles in use throughout Aviara. Review timelines typically run two to four weeks depending on scope and whether proposed materials are pre-approved. Do you do work in Bressi Ranch and Calavera Hills?

Yes. Bressi Ranch and Calavera Hills are regular service areas. Both communities are newer master-plan inventory (mostly 2000s-2010s) with concrete tile and standing-seam metal mix on single-family, plus low-slope membrane on the attached and multi-family portions. Major-replacement window has not fully opened yet on most of this inventory but partial work, repair, and warranty-period assessment are routine. HOA architectural review applies throughout.
